2025 SESSION INTRODUCED 25102827D HOUSE BILL NO. 2373 Offered January 8, 2025 Prefiled January 8, 2025 A BILL to amend the Code of Virginia by adding a section numbered 22.1-1.1, relating to public elementary and secondary school students; parents' bill of rights established. PatronHiggins Committee Referral Pending Be it enacted by the General Assembly of Virginia: 1. That the Code of Virginia is amended by adding a section numbered 22.1-1.1 as follows: 22.1-1.1. Parents' bill of rights. Consistent with 1-240.1, the parents of each public elementary or secondary school student in the Commonwealth have the right to: 1. Review any books, curricula, or instructional materials being taught or made available to their child; 2. Opt their child out of any sexually explicit instructional material or assignments as set forth in 22.1-16.8; 3. Know who is instructing their child, including any outside presenters or lecturers; 4. Visit their child's school during school hours to meet with, or to schedule a meeting with, a school representative; 5. Review all records created or held by the school about their child; 6. Receive information regarding the collection and transmission of their child's data and opt out of any data collection without penalty to their child; 7. Be notified of, review ahead of time, and opt their child out of any surveys offered to them by any school representative; 8. Be notified of any situation that directly affects their child's safety at school; 9. Be made aware of any counseling services that their child is receiving while at school; and 10. Make all medical decisions for their child.
